It looks, smells, and, unfortunately sounds like a tent
So this is the same stuff camping gear is made of. I actually don't mind the smell because it reminds me of camping. However, you know how when you're camping and you ALWAYS know when the person next to you or in the other tent is awake because of how loud the tent fabric is when it's even slightly jostled? Thats kind of what this fabric sounds like.Additionally, the plastic rings that come with the kit to hang up the curtain were all stuck to the vinyl that goes over the top of the bed, so there's all these "c" shaped markings that let the light in where the black backing peeled off. It's kind of a cool pattern, but kind of defeats the purpose of having a blackout bed curtain. The plastic rings aren't very forgiving, either. If you accidentally sit or step on the drape, you'll probably end up with a broken ring, so just a heads up. That said, the parts that weren't damaged by the plastic rings do aa great job of keeping out the light., and it IS great for winter since it shuts out the cold. We can actually save a little on our heating bill by turning it down more at night and then get in our little indoor tent. Just wish it didn't sound like a tarp flapping in the wind every time one of us gets in or out of bed.
